Princess Basma highlights mentoring, English skills as keys to young women’s success

AMMAN — HRH Princess Basma, chairperson of the Jordanian National Forum for Women (JNFW), on Monday stressed the importance of mentoring and English-language programme as pathways to young women’s success.

Speaking at the closing ceremony of the programme, implemented by JNFW under the “Encouraging young women and inspiring networks for inclusive and transformational education” project, Princess Basma highlighted such initiatives’ role in empowering young women, developing their personal and professional skills, and expanding opportunities to pursue their aspirations.

She also underscored the importance of investing in young women’s education and empowerment as a “foundation for a more prosperous and sustainable future,” the Jordan News Agency, Petra, reported.

The princess praised the project’s focus on introducing participants to non-traditional career fields in key sectors, while boosting their English-language proficiency and communication skills to enhance their employment prospects and future career opportunities.

The programme targeted 108 young women from several governorates, providing specialised training in English and non-traditional employment sectors aligned with the evolving demands of the labour market.

Princess Basma also commended the efforts of organisers, partners, teachers and volunteers, stressing the value of such partnerships in supporting young women’s empowerment and broadening their future opportunities.

The programme adopted a vocational mentoring approach, whereby female mentors with expertise in the targeted fields were selected to guide, train and support the participating young women.

It also included regular sessions, practical learning activities, and field visits to relevant institutions operating in the respective sectors, in partnership with Microsoft Jordan, the Business and Professional Women’s Association, and the Irbid Directorate of Tourism.

JNFW seeks to build a “sustainable” women’s network focused on intergenerational and cross-sector learning among women from diverse professional backgrounds.

It also aims to raise young women’s awareness of their role in public life and highlight “influential” female role models who can inspire others to overcome social challenges and engage more actively in the labour market.
